WebPage through a document like a book using the Side to Side command On the View tab, select Side to Side. Flip through pages with your finger if you have a touch screen, or use the horizontal scroll bar or mouse wheel to move through the pages. Note: Side-to-side page movement switches off the ability to pick a zoom setting.
